These oils are valued for their excellent thermal stability, low vapor pressure, and resistance to oxidation. Such properties enable consistent heat transfer over long operating cycles, reducing the need for frequent fluid replacement and system maintenance.

Technological advancements in formulation and refining processes have further strengthened market potential. Modern diaryl alkane oils are engineered to minimize thermal cracking and fouling, which enhances system cleanliness and heat transfer efficiency. These improvements translate into longer equipment life and reduced operational risk, making them attractive for high-value industrial installations.

Safety and environmental considerations also influence adoption. Compared to some traditional heat transfer media, diaryl alkane oils offer predictable behavior and stable chemical profiles. This reliability supports compliance with industrial safety standards and simplifies handling procedures, especially in large-scale facilities where risk management is a priority.
